    SmarterASP.NET Pros and Cons

    Pros

    • Fast Loading - Cloudflare CDN and SSD Storage contribute to fast load times, which attract customers and boost SEO rankings.
    • Storage Technology - Data is stored in Dell EqualLogic San for enhanced performance and reliability.
    • Money-Back Guarantee - It offers a 60-day free trial and a full money-back guarantee.
    • Stellar Security - Protects your website with a firewall, anti-virus protection, and automatic data backups.

    Cons

    • Dedicated Servers - At present there are no dedicated server plans available.
    • Linux Support - SmarterASP.Net is now providing Linux hosting, although its technical support may be less familiar with Linux’s OS.

    SmarterASP.NET Prices and Payment Methods

    Windows hosting plans tend to be more expensive than its Linux cousin, however, SmarterASP.Net bucks the trend.

    Shared Hosting, including .Net Basic, costs $2.95p/m and provides hosting services for one website, with unlimited bandwidth, and one-click installation for many top platforms.

    For users with security concerns over shared hosting, SmarterASP.Net provides both VPS and semi-dedicated servers, with the VPS SSD1 plan starting at $99.95p/m, featuring root access.

    SmarterASP.NET Load Times & Reliability

    In the Linux/Windows epic struggle for server dominance, Windows servers are considered the less successful contender.                                                                                          With investment in state-of-the-art hardware and software, SmarterASP.Net puts this idea to bed, to keep servers running and sites loading quickly.

    I tested SmarterASP.Net over several months, and am happy to report it keeps to, and often surpasses, its 99.9% uptime guarantee, while the load time tests were just as encouraging averaging under 1s.

    My Conclusion About SmarterASP.Net

    SmarterASP.Net has created an upscale yet affordable Windows hosting service, using state-of-the-art hardware for minimal downtime and fast load times.                                    Its basic plans include an array of developer tools, although if you’re a beginner, you may be more suited to Hostinger with its tutorials for novices.  

    With data centers solely in the US, A2 Hosting might be better suited with its Asian and European bases.
